Online Gaming and Emotional Regulation: Healthy Outlet or Emotional Suppression?

On the positive side, online gaming can function as a controlled emotional outlet. Engaging gameplay allows players to release tension, channel frustration, and experience enjoyment after demanding activities. Cooperative games can generate positive emotions through teamwork, shared success, and social connection.

Games also expose players to emotional challenges in safe environments. Losing matches, facing setbacks, and adapting to unpredictable outcomes help players practice coping with disappointment, patience, and resilience. Over time, this can strengthen emotional control and tolerance for stress.

Additionally, narrative-driven games encourage emotional awareness. Storylines that explore moral dilemmas, empathy, or character development can stimulate reflection and emotional understanding, particularly when players actively engage with the content.

However, critics argue that gaming may promote emotional suppression. Some players rely on games to avoid confronting real-life emotions such as anxiety, sadness, or conflict. Instead of processing these feelings, they may escape into virtual environments, delaying emotional growth.

Another concern involves emotional volatility. Competitive and high-stakes games can trigger anger, frustration, or hostility, especially when combined with toxic interactions. Without self-regulation, these emotional responses may carry over into daily life.

Excessive gaming may also reduce emotional awareness. Constant stimulation and distraction can limit time for reflection, making it harder for individuals to recognize and process their emotional states outside gaming sessions.

In conclusion, online gaming can support emotional regulation by providing relief, resilience training, and reflective experiences. At the same time, overreliance on gaming as an emotional escape may hinder genuine emotional processing. Mindful engagement, emotional awareness, and balanced coping strategies are essential to ensure gaming contributes positively to emotional well-being.
